There are so many ways to promote webinars online these days. There are even more methods than ever before. This is why it can be so hard to get started. Here are some tips to help get you started in the right direction:

 

Branding - It is very important to brand yourself and your webinars. You need to have your own name and face on your webinar events. You should always represent yourself and the company in a very professional way. Use business cards, make a press release, t-shirts, and anything else that portray who you are and what your company is about. Your potential customers will remember you and recognize your face after the event, which is why it is so important to do this right.

Target Audience - Once you have a good reputation and brand, you want to find your target audience. This is pretty much the same as any other marketing campaign. You want to find out who is going to be interested in your webinar, what they might want to know, what kind of solutions they might be looking for, and how they might be interested in buying your products. Once you know who your target audience is, you can start designing your webinar invitations and other promotional materials. These will make a big impact on your audience and how your webinar goes.

 

Server - You will need a hosting server for your webinar if you decide to host it online. Your host should be able to provide you with all of the resources and services that you need to create and host your webinar. You will need to have enough bandwidth and storage to accommodate all of your attendees. Make sure that your host has servers that are very reliable and up-to-date.

 

Internet connection - Once you have your webinar host and have set everything up, you will need to be able to stream the live conference to your visitors. There are many different ways that this can be done. It is usually best to use a live streaming video webinar platform. There are many free options available for you to choose from.
